Job Description

Tarboro Health and Rehabilitation is currently seeking an Accounts Payable/Payroll Clerk to join our team of dedicated caregivers. Experience is preferred.
Benefits include:
Competitive Pay, commensurate with experience Regular Employee Appreciation Events to include refreshments and gifts Fun and supportive work environment that encourages teamwork and collaboration Initial uniforms provided Flexible Work Schedule Career Growth and Training Opportunities Paid Time Off and 8 Paid Holidays New health insurance plans to include a prescription plan, FSA and HSA plans Dental and Vision insurance 401K with employer match Tuition Reimbursement Programs Responsibilities include: Create, maintain, and update semi-monthly payroll data in the payroll system, including hourly and salary data and incentive bonus programs Record changes affecting wages including taxes, direct deposits, and wage increases Review payroll registers and correct errors to ensure accuracy of payroll Conduct weekly payroll data entry within set timelines Reconcile, code, and enter invoices and upload into accounting system for payment Contacts suppliers, buyers, and employees to research questionable items on invoices Performs basic Accounts Payable (AP) analysis with knowledge of policies and procedures Conduct initial orientation to newly hired employees, helping with the understanding of company benefits, payroll processes, and company policies based on employee handbook Ensure all new hire paperwork and background checks are completed within state and federal guidelines Assemble, audit, and maintain new hire personnel files for all active projects Respond to verification of employment requests within 48 hours At SanStone Health & Rehabilitation, we offer employment opportunities in North Carolina that are filled with purpose.
